WASHINGTON, D.C.: The House of Representatives was set to impeach President Donald Trump for inciting insurrection Wednesday, with several key Republicans backing the Democrat-led push to bring down the real estate tycoon in flames just a week before he leaves office.
Washington was in a state of siege as lawmakers opened their session, with armed National Guard soldiers deployed, central streets barred to cars and public spaces fenced off.
